摘要
Nonunion remains a major complication after skeletal trauma. In the last decade, extracorporeal shock wave therapy has become a common tool for the treatment of delayed unions or non-unions. With the help of a review of the literature, the current author gave an overview of indications, choices of devices, success rates and complications for ESWT in the treatment of non-unions. The conceivable mechanism was also outlined.
